Winding mechanism Technical Field The utility model belongs to the technical field of suture production equipment, and particularly relates to a winding mechanism. Background Medical sutures refer to special medical lines used for ligature hemostasis, suture hemostasis and tissue suturing in surgical operations, and are divided into absorbable sutures and non-absorbable sutures. The absorbable suture line needs to be coated with protective liquid to protect the absorbable suture line in the production process. Above-mentioned patent not only is convenient for evenly smear the protection liquid to the suture line, has still reduced the dust and has fallen on the protection liquid, is convenient for change the wind-up roll that the rolling was accomplished, labour saving and time saving, but the suture line when scribbling the protection liquid, does not carry out the accuse of short time and does or strike off the protection liquid when, leads to the protection liquid to be rolled up with the suture line together easily, when packing, will lead to the condition that a large amount of protection liquids overflowed. Disclosure of utility model The utility model aims to provide a winding mechanism, which aims to solve the problems that when a suture line in the prior art is fully coated with a protective liquid, the protective liquid and the suture line are wound together easily when the protective liquid is not dried or scraped off for a short time, and a large amount of protective liquid overflows during packaging.
